The ICON logo has been reworked to read: "I AM CON ARTIST." The sign was also tagged with the demand, "LET STAGE LIVE!" and the #SaveNYC hashtag.
![](https://blogger.googleusercontent.com/img/b/R29vZ2xl/AVvXsEgA8XwZcfgG24CeMoYBBRt8Q9IykhGOoG9jAdHJAa3DqmNys2fegLx7vT1lhHWEWN3FtrelbbKMHxwUIwoOgQJIffuoKh25inDT3h1vKyly35CjeBRZAgmVCJr94sqpk_yhsOGHiv1u7lY/s320/2015-04-16+07.05.33+pm.png)
This address happens to be the former home of New York School poet Frank O'Hara. Not his last place, which was demolished for a condo, but the place where he wrote enough poems, the GVSHP put a plaque on the wall. Maybe it was Frank's ghost, home from a long stroll, who marked up the Icon sign.
Further along, at 445 E. 9th, he wrote the same messages on another ICON sign. What looks like a second hand added: "The rent is too fucking high, you greedy fucks!" To which someone else replied, "yes!!"
A 300-square-foot retail space here goes for $5,000 per month.
